Understanding Caloric Absorption and Gut Health
A common misconception in nutrition is that all calories are created equal. For example, when consuming almonds, a person might think that eating 160 calories means their body absorbs all of those calories. However, research shows that only about 130 calories are absorbed due to the fiber present in almonds. This fiber plays a crucial role in our digestive system; it forms a gel-like substance that hinders the absorption of certain calories, allowing them to reach the gut microbiome. This microbiome, comprised of trillions of bacteria, benefits from the fiber as it transforms these calories into short-chain fatty acids, which have protective effects against chronic metabolic diseases.
Thus, the saying "a calorie eaten is not a calorie absorbed" rings true. When we consume fiber-rich foods, we are not merely feeding ourselves but also nourishing our gut bacteria, which can lead to enhanced health outcomes. This intricate relationship between our food intake and gut health underscores the necessity of focusing on the quality of calories rather than merely their quantity.
The Fructose Dilemma
Another critical aspect of nutrition is the role of fructose. Unlike the fiber-rich fruits such as berries, which provide essential nutrients while minimizing harmful effects, fructose found in processed foods poses significant health risks. Fructose does not have any essential function in the human body and can lead to addiction-like behaviors and metabolic disturbances when consumed excessively.
The key to navigating fructose consumption lies in the presence of fiber. In fruits, fiber mitigates the absorption of fructose, allowing our microbiome to benefit from it rather than our bodies experiencing negative effects. This distinction highlights the importance of choosing whole, unprocessed foods over sugary snacks, which often lack fiber and other beneficial nutrients.
Three Principles of Healthy Eating
To promote better health through nutrition, three guiding principles have emerged:
-
Protect the Liver: Foods that support liver function, such as leafy greens and healthy fats, can help mitigate the adverse effects of sugar and processed foods.
-
Feed the Gut: Incorporating fiber-rich foods into our diets nourishes our gut microbiome, leading to improved digestive health and overall well-being.
-
Support the Brain: Foods rich in omega-3 fatty acids, antioxidants, and vitamins can enhance cognitive function and emotional health.
By adhering to these principles, even ultra-processed foods can be made healthier, provided they align with these criteria.
The Quest for Life on Mars
Parallel to our exploration of nutrition is the ongoing quest for understanding life on Mars, exemplified by the missions of the Perseverance rover. This rover has been tasked with collecting rock samples from a region known as Jezero Crater, which is believed to have once hosted a lake. Scientists hypothesize that the rock formations, particularly those displaying unusual structures, may hold clues to past microbial life on Mars.
The discovery of iron and sulfur in these rocks suggests chemical reactions that could indicate biological activity. While iron can undergo transformations without biological influence, sulfur's presence in a reduced form is typically indicative of microbial activity. This potential biosignature raises the exciting prospect of uncovering evidence of life beyond Earth.
However, the success of these missions is contingent on funding and political support. As budget constraints threaten the future of space exploration, the significance of these discoveries becomes even more crucial.
